31struct simtec_i2c_data {
32 struct resource *ioarea;
33 void __iomem *reg;
34 struct i2c_adapter adap;
35 struct i2c_algo_bit_data bit;
36};
37
38#define CMD_SET_SDA (1<<2)
39#define CMD_SET_SCL (1<<3)
40
41#define STATE_SDA (1<<0)
42#define STATE_SCL (1<<1)
43
44/* i2c bit-bus functions */
45
46static void simtec_i2c_setsda(void *pw, int state)
47{
48 struct simtec_i2c_data *pd = pw;
49 writeb(CMD_SET_SDA | (state ? STATE_SDA : 0), pd->reg);
50}
51
52static void simtec_i2c_setscl(void *pw, int state)
53{
54 struct simtec_i2c_data *pd = pw;
55 writeb(CMD_SET_SCL | (state ? STATE_SCL : 0), pd->reg);
56}
57
58static int simtec_i2c_getsda(void *pw)
59{
60 struct simtec_i2c_data *pd = pw;
61 return readb(pd->reg) & STATE_SDA ? 1 : 0;
62}
63
64static int simtec_i2c_getscl(void *pw)
65{
66 struct simtec_i2c_data *pd = pw;
67 return readb(pd->reg) & STATE_SCL ? 1 : 0;
68}
